Mugatu's Chances of Winning This Year's Preakness Stakes

Mugatu offers the biggest payout in this year's Preakness Stakes: $4000 on a $100 bet.  That alone is too great a temptation for some to place a wager, even if there is plenty going against him.

In case you were wondering,  the Average Joe Racing Stables and Dan Wells-owned horse got his name from a "Zoolander" character.

He was sired by Blofeld out of the Union Rags mare Union Way and is trained by Jeff Engler.

Mugatu has run 12 races and won only one.  He finished 5th in his only graded start, the Blue Grass Stakes.

This will be Engler's first Preakness appearance, having won more than 200 races.  He has not had success with graded races, however.  A win here would be his first.

Jockey Joe Bravo's best appearance at a Preakness Stakes was fifth aboard Teeth of the Dog in 2012.  While he hasn't won a Triple Crown race yet, Bravo has over 5600 victories under his belt.
